**Release checklist — Pennon flag rollout**

Confirm the Pennon rollout framework gates are set to 5% canary before merge. Kill switch must be tested in staging, not assumed. If flag evaluation latency exceeds budget, roll back immediately and page the platform lead. Verify the deployed artifact against the trace token listed below.

build token for yajof-bajof: htk31_506ff1188f74596b5bb2eec94edc43c

Ticket: Surveylark offline-mode vault locked. Hey — the credential vault that signs offline sync bundles for Surveylark locked itself overnight, so field crews can't upload cached survey data. Nothing's lost, but the Tuesday release should hold until it's reopened. Release manager can do the unseal from the packaging console; it takes two minutes. The passphrase you'll be prompted for is noted just below.

vault phrase of bagaf-kajeg = jorath-feniel-briir-siliel-ralix

## Onboarding: Brightmoor Partner SFTP Drop

Partners upload nightly CSV feeds to the Brightmoor SFTP drop, which our Tidewell job sweeps at 02:00. Files must pass checksum validation before ingestion; failures land in the quarantine folder for manual review. Access to the drop host is tightly controlled — first-time connections require the recovery passphrase provided directly below.

recovery phrase for bawip-tawip: wenix-praion

**Vendor note: Inkmill markdown pipeline**

Rendering for Parchway docs is outsourced to Inkmill under an annual contract, renewing each March. They handle sanitization and PDF export; we own the upload queue. SLA: 4-hour response on rendering failures. Escalate only after two failed retries. Their support desk is reachable at the address below.

billing contact of hahaf-baguf = zorael.tammir.jorius@sivrelhq.internal